Brunei-Poland Trade: In 2023, Brunei exported $233k to Poland. The main products that Brunei exported to Poland were Other Organo-Inorganic Compounds ($57.8k), Acyclic alcohol derivatives (halogenated, sulphonated, nitrated) ($47.3k), and Knit T-shirts ($29.5k). Over the past 5 years the exports of Brunei to Poland have increased at an annualized rate of 13.5%, from $124k in 2018 to $233k in 2023.
In 2023, Brunei did not export any services to Poland.
Poland-Brunei Trade: In 2023, Poland exported $1.85M to Brunei. The main products that Poland exported to Brunei were Beauty Products ($183k), Milk ($149k), and High-voltage Protection Equipment ($113k). Over the past 5 years the exports of Poland to Brunei have decreased at an annualized rate of 12%, from $3.52M in 2018 to $1.85M in 2023.
In 2023, Poland did not export any services to Brunei.
Comparison In 2023, Brunei ranked 101 in total exports ($10.9B), and does not have data regarding Economic Complexity Index. That same year, Poland ranked 24 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 1.09), and 23 in total exports ($339B).
